When you are an entrepreneur, you need a credit card designed with the needs of the entrepreneur in mind. Perks that are normally associated with a regular consumer credit card may not be right for you, but rather you could use features that will help your business. While there tends to not be as many choices for a small business card, you have several good ones that will be just fine for your business.

When it comes to a credit card for your business, there are ones available from big card issuers, including Visa business credit cards. Most of the business credit cards include features that allow you to track charges, get additional cards for employees, and adjust the credit limit for additional cards. These business specific cards tend to give a lot of control to you, the entrepreneur.
